StudySmarter Expert Advice 🤫
We think this is how you could land Newly Qualified Teacher (ECT) in Bristol
✨Tip Number 1
Network with other Early Career Teachers and educators in Bristol. Attend local teaching events or workshops to meet people who can provide insights and potentially refer you to job openings.
✨Tip Number 2
Utilise social media platforms like LinkedIn to connect with schools and educational professionals in Bristol. Follow relevant pages and engage with their content to increase your visibility.
✨Tip Number 3
Consider reaching out directly to schools in Bristol that interest you. Express your enthusiasm for teaching and inquire about any upcoming opportunities, even if they aren't currently advertised.
✨Tip Number 4
Prepare for interviews by researching common questions for Early Career Teachers. Practise your responses and think of examples from your training that showcase your skills and passion for teaching.

Some tips for your application 🫡
Tailor Your CV: Make sure your CV highlights your teaching qualifications, relevant experience, and any special skills that make you a great fit for the role. Focus on your teaching philosophy and how it aligns with the values of Academics.
Craft a Compelling Cover Letter: Write a cover letter that showcases your passion for teaching and your eagerness to start your career in Bristol. Mention why you want to work with Academics specifically and how their support can help you thrive as an Early Career Teacher.
Highlight Relevant Experience: If you have any teaching placements, volunteer work, or tutoring experience, be sure to include these in your application. Specific examples of how you've engaged with students or contributed to a learning environment will strengthen your application.
Proofread Your Application: Before submitting, carefully proofread your CV and cover letter for any spelling or grammatical errors. A polished application reflects your attention to detail and professionalism, which are crucial in the teaching profession.
How to prepare for a job interview at Academics Ltd.
✨Know Your Curriculum
Familiarise yourself with the curriculum you'll be teaching. Be prepared to discuss how you would approach lesson planning and adapt your teaching methods to meet the needs of diverse learners.
✨Showcase Your Passion for Teaching
During the interview, express your enthusiasm for education and working with students. Share personal anecdotes or experiences that highlight your commitment to fostering a positive learning environment.
✨Prepare for Behaviour Management Questions
Expect questions about how you would handle classroom behaviour. Have specific strategies in mind and be ready to explain how you would create a respectful and engaging classroom atmosphere.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, ask thoughtful questions about the school culture, support for new teachers, and opportunities for professional development.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
